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36501155 832375972 8265809716
45 3866
45 3866
910190 2946 9812890936
All about undefined
Interested in learning more?
45 3866
910190 2946 9812890936
See more
4245 43572368970
27849098465 5804410242 349 038
See more
47119444 5121003868 933579
85454486 03 21 827480
See more